The property has been developed by the present owner over the past fifteen years and has primarily been run as a livery yard and children's’ tracking centre together with a small cattery. This has provided a fantastic lifestyle business which is ready to be taken on by the next owners.

The house was built subject to an Equestrian Occupancy Condition which states that it must be used solely in connection with the operation and security of the horses and stables.

The property lies in a wonderfully secluded setting surrounded by beautiful rolling, part wooded countryside which offers extensive hacking along various bridleways and through Charmouth Forest. A public footpath runs through the property.

Nearby Axminster offers a range of day to day shops, amenities and junior school with further facilities in the popular coastal town of Lyme Regis.

A detached house built in 2008 with a practical open plan arrangement on the ground floor and two large bedrooms on the first floor which could easily be subdivided to create four smaller rooms if desired.

There is oil fired central heating upstairs and the accommodation in brief is as follows. Please refer to floor plan for approx. room sizes:

The Main Entrance to the rear is a stable style door leading into the Kitchen which is fitted with a range of built-in base and island units with granite and hardwood worksurfaces, two oven oil fired Aga, Belfast sink, plumbing for dishwasher, stone floor, wide opening to the Dining Room which also has a stone floor.

The Sitting Room has three sets of external glazed double doors, oak floor and a large brick inglenook style fireplace with a log-burner (also heats hot water).

From the dining room a door leads through to the Inner Hall with stairs to the first floor, external front door, stone floor and built in storage cupboards.

The Utility Room has a range of built-in base and eye-level storage cupboards, stone floor, plumbing for washing machine, 1½ bowl sink and external stable style door with an adjacent Wet Room with a shower, WC, wash hand basin, ladder radiator, fully tiled walls and floor.

On the First Floor there are Two Large Bedrooms which could be subdivided to create four smaller bedrooms if required plus a Bathroom with rolled top bath, WC, wash hand basin and stone floor.

OUTSIDE, EQUESTRIAN FACILITIES & LAND

The property is set down a long drive which is shared with two neighbouring properties and which is also a public footpath. The extensive range of outbuildings is as follows with approx. sizes:

Former Dairy converted to provide:

            Kitchen 14’ x 7’4 (c. 4.3m x 2.2m) built-in range of storage units, stainless steel sink, tiled floor, plumbing for washing machine

               Storage Room 14’3 x 7’7 (c. 4.4m x 2.2m)

               Cattery 28’8 x 15’3 (c. 8.7m x 4.6m) with eight    internal cat pens and external run with a fenced     enclosure for private use only

This building has scope for conversion to ancillary accommodation subject to the necessary planning permission.

Stable Yard built of block under GI roof set on a concrete base with light, power and water supplies, formerly had planning permission for a cattery currently providing:

               Five Loose Boxes each 12’6 x 11’8 (c.3.8m x 3.5m) and Tack Room

Three Covered Yards with a total of 23 Internal Loose Boxes, some individual tack cupboards, kitchenette, WC, light, power and water supplies and a Large Loft 48’ x 35’ (c. 14.6m x 10.7m) used for additional tack rooms and storage.

Timber Stable Yard with box profile roof and concrete base with Two Loose Boxes each 20’ x 10’ (c. 6.1m x 3m)

Hay Barn 35’ x 20’ (about 10.7m x 6.1m) with GI cladding

Manege 40m x 30m sand and fibre surface, post and railed

The Land adjoins in gently sloping south facing pasture subdivided with post and rail into a number of paddocks. Each paddock has access to a water trough, there are some lovely mature oak trees and beautiful far reaching views over Charmouth Forest to the countryside beyond.

 IN ALL APPROX. 18 ACRES  (About 7.3 Hectares)
